From Liverpool Lime Street By Bus Or Taxi, The main railway station in Liverpool is Lime Street which is over three miles from the ground and is really too far to walk (although it is mostly downhill on the way back to the station), so either head for Kirkdale station or jump in a taxi (about 8). Bus - There are numerous bus routes from Liverpool centre to Goodison including the 19/19A, 20, 21, 130,, 210, and 250, from Queens Square Bus Station. Goodison Park stadium tours Everton organise guided stadium tours that include visits to the dressing rooms and players tunnel.
